    I picked up Warren Moon's autobiography "Never Give Up On Your Dream" this week. To be honest I found it to be a little disappointing, but worth reading if you were a fan of Moon's. I found out a few new things but overall, much of the info in the book was stuff I'd heard about before. You do get a better overall feel for Moon the man though (he's always such a guarded guy it's been difficult to get a real sense of who he really was a person).

    A couple of things stood out for me personally...

    - Moon described a game in Buffalo in November 1985 that took place in a downpour of freezing rain as the worst game he ever played as a pro. It was the first NFL game I ever attended in person. It was brutal.

    - Moon realy disliked Jerry Glanville... really.

    - not once in the entire book dd Warren Moon mention Drew Hill. He seemed to name every receiver he ever played with (in the NCAA, CFL and NFL), but not even the vaguest reference to Hill. Weird.
